Engineering Distributed Objects

Λεπτομέρειες βιβλιογραφικής εγγραφής
Κύριος συγγραφέας: Emmerich, Wolfgang (Συγγραφέας)
Μορφή: Βιβλίο
Γλώσσα:Greek
Έκδοση: Chichester John Wiley & Sons c2000
Θέματα:
Πίνακας περιεχομένων:
  • Preface Acknowledgements Part I : Concepts 1. Distributed Systems 1.1 What Is a Distributed System? 1.2 Examples of Distributed Systems 1.3 Distributed System Requirements 1.4 Transparency in Distributed Systems Key Points Self Assessment Futher Reading 2. Designing Distributed Objects 2.1 Evolution of Object Technology 2.2 UML Representations for Distributed Object Design 2.3 A Meta-Model for Distributed Objects 2.4 Local versus Distributed Objects Key Points Self Assessment Futher Reading Part II Middleware for Distributed Objects 3. Principles of Object - Oriented Middleware 3.1 Computer Networks 3.2 Types of Middleware 3.3 Object - Oriented Middleware 3.4 Developing with Object - Oriented Middleware Key Points Self Assessment Futher Reading 4. CORBA, COM and Java/RMI 4.1 CORBA 4.2 COM 4.3 Java/RMI Key Points Self Assessment Futher Reading 5 Resolving Heterogeneity 5.1 Heterogeneous Programming Languages 5.2 Heterogeneous Middleware 5.3 Heterogeneous Data Representation Key Points Self Assessment Futher Reading 6. Dynamic Object Requests 6.1 Motivating Examples 6.2 Dynamic Invocation 6.3 Reflection 6.4 Designing Generic Applications Key Points Self Assessment Futher Reading Part III Common Design Problems 7. Advanced Communication between Distributed Objects 7.1 Request Synchronization 7.2 Request Multiplicity 7.3 Request Reliability Key Points Self Assessment Futher Reading 8 Locating Distributed Objects 8.1 Object Naming 8.2 Object Trading Key Points Self Assessment Futher Reading 9 Life Cycle of Distributed Objects 9.1 Object Life Cycle 9.2 Composite Objects 9.3 Composite Object Life Cycle Key Points Self Assessment Futher Reading